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93293543 372 02727407147 708608 58918516
03299382 06868275
03299382 06868275
85326446833 762 0166
All about undefined
Interested in learning more?
03299382 06868275
85326446833 762 0166
See more
065 733074
74 3026167131 59360790
See more
57 00
0971892 313086851 599 6462 733
See more